Transaction f66786389042def80c99bee5abf2effb3a30d9418840514b8eaab8566efde016
1 Input
1 Output
-
f66786389042def80c99bee5abf2effb3a30d9418840514b8eaab8566efde016:0
- value
- 123691
- script pubkey
- OP_0 OP_PUSHBYTES_20 0bd91714f512aaf43864517a65758a48eea37b13
- address
- bc1qp0v3w984z240gwry29ax2av2frh2x7cn038mr4